How To Migrate Data From Microsoft Access To SQL Server Los Angeles

Worth of Microsoft Gain Access To in Your Company
Mid to huge companies might have hundreds to hundreds of computer. Each desktop has basic software application that permits personnel to complete computing tasks without the treatment of the organization's IT department. This offers the primary tenet of desktop computer: encouraging individuals to raise performance and also reduced expenses via decentralized computing.

As the globe's most preferred desktop computer data source, Microsoft Access is made use of in mostly all companies that use Microsoft Windows. As individuals become much more proficient in the procedure of these applications, they begin to identify remedies to service tasks that they themselves could apply. The all-natural evolution of this process is that spreadsheets and also databases are created and also preserved by end-users to manage their daily jobs.

This vibrant enables both efficiency as well as dexterity as individuals are empowered to fix organisation issues without the treatment of their company's Information Technology infrastructure. Microsoft Accessibility suits this area by offering a desktop database setting where end-users can quickly create data source applications with tables, questions, types and also reports. Access is excellent for inexpensive solitary individual or workgroup data source applications.

Yet this power comes with a rate. As more customers make use of Microsoft Access to handle their work, issues of data safety and security, dependability, maintainability, scalability and also administration come to be intense. Individuals who constructed these options are seldom trained to be data source experts, designers or system administrators. As data sources outgrow the capabilities of the initial author, they have to relocate into a more durable atmosphere.

While some individuals consider this a reason end-users shouldn't ever before use Microsoft Accessibility, we consider this to be the exception rather than the policy. The majority of Microsoft Access databases are developed by end-users and never ever need to graduate to the next level. Executing a technique to create every end-user database "professionally" would certainly be a substantial waste of resources.

For the rare Microsoft Accessibility data sources that are so successful that they should progress, SQL Server supplies the following natural progression. Without shedding the existing investment in the application (table designs, information, queries, forms, records, macros and components), data can be relocated to SQL Server and the Access database connected to it. When in SQL Server, various other systems such as Aesthetic Studio.NET can be made use of to develop Windows, internet and/or mobile services. The Access database application may be completely changed or a hybrid service might be produced.

To find out more, read our paper Microsoft Gain access to within a Company's Overall Data source Approach.

Microsoft Accessibility as well as SQL Database Architectures

Microsoft Gain access to is the premier desktop computer data source product readily available for Microsoft Windows. Considering that its introduction in 1992, Gain access to has supplied a versatile platform for novices as well as power customers to develop single-user and also small workgroup database applications.

Microsoft Access has actually delighted in wonderful success due to the fact that it spearheaded the principle of stepping users through a difficult task with using Wizards. This, together with an intuitive question designer, one of the most effective desktop computer reporting devices as well as the addition of macros and a coding atmosphere, all add to making Accessibility the very best choice for desktop computer database advancement.

Considering that Accessibility is designed to be easy to use as well as approachable, it was never meant as a system for the most reliable and also robust applications. As a whole, upsizing must happen when these features become crucial for the application. Luckily, the versatility of Gain access to allows you to upsize to SQL Server in a variety of methods, from a fast economical, data-moving scenario to full application redesign.

Access offers an abundant range of data architectures that permit it to handle information in a selection of means. When considering an upsizing task, it is very important to understand the selection of means Access may be set up to utilize its native Jet database format as well as SQL Server in both solitary as well as multi-user settings.

Gain access to and also the Jet Engine
Microsoft Gain access to has its own data source engine-- the Microsoft Jet Data source Engine (additionally called the ACE with Accessibility 2007's introduction of the ACCDB format). Jet was designed from the beginning to support single individual and multiuser data sharing on a lan. Databases have a maximum dimension of 2 GB, although an Access database could attach to other data sources through connected look at this site tables and also several backend data sources to workaround the 2 GB limit.

But Accessibility navigate to this website is more than a data source engine. It is likewise an application development environment that permits individuals to develop inquiries, create kinds as well as records, as well as create macros Homepage as well as Aesthetic Standard for Applications (VBA) module code to automate an application. In its default arrangement, Gain access to utilizes Jet internally to keep its style items such as kinds, records, macros, and also components as well as makes use of Jet to save all table data.

Among the main benefits of Accessibility upsizing is that you can redesign your application to remain to use its types, reports, macros and components, and replace the Jet Engine with SQL Server. This permits the best of both worlds: the convenience of use of Gain access to with the reliability as well as safety and security of SQL Server.

Before you try to transform an Access database to SQL Server, ensure you recognize:

Which applications belong in Microsoft Accessibility vs. SQL Server? Not every data source must be changed.
The factors for upsizing your data source. See to it SQL Server gives you just what you seek.

The tradeoffs for doing so. There are pluses as well as minuses relying on what you're attempting to enhance. Ensure you are not moving to SQL Server exclusively for performance factors.
In most cases, performance reduces when an application is upsized, specifically for fairly tiny databases (under 200 MEGABYTES).

Some efficiency issues are unassociated to the backend data source. Badly made queries as well as table style will not be repaired by upsizing. Microsoft Access tables use some features that SQL Server tables do not such as an automatic refresh when the information changes. SQL Server needs a specific requery.

Options for Migrating Microsoft Access to SQL Server
There are numerous options for hosting SQL Server data sources:

A regional circumstances of SQL Express, which is a free version of SQL Server can be mounted on each individual's equipment

A shared SQL Server database on your network

A cloud host such as SQL Azure. Cloud hosts have safety that restriction which IP addresses could obtain information, so set IP addresses and/or VPN is essential.
There are several ways to upsize your Microsoft Access data sources to SQL Server:

Relocate the information to SQL Server and also connect to it from your Access database while maintaining the existing Accessibility application.
Changes could be should support SQL Server inquiries as well as differences from Access databases.
Transform an Access MDB database to an Access Data Task (ADP) that links directly to a SQL Server database.
Considering that ADPs were deprecated in Accessibility 2013, we do not advise this choice.
Use Microsoft Gain Access To with MS Azure.
With Office365, your data is uploaded right into a SQL Server data source held by SQL Azure with a Gain access to Web front end
Proper for fundamental viewing and also editing and enhancing of information across the internet
Regrettably, Gain Access To Web Applications do not have the personalization features comparable to VBA in Accessibility desktop solutions
Move the entire application to the.NET Structure, ASP.NET, as well as SQL Server platform, or recreate it on SharePoint.
A crossbreed remedy that places the data in SQL Server with an additional front-end plus a Gain access to front-end database.
SQL Server can be the typical variation hosted on a business quality web server or a totally free SQL Server Express version set up on your COMPUTER

Database Obstacles in an Organization

Every company has to get rid of database difficulties to fulfill their objective. These challenges consist of:
• Taking full advantage of roi
• Handling personnels
• Rapid implementation
• Adaptability as well as maintainability
• Scalability (second).

Making The Most Of Return on Investment.

Making best use of return on investment is much more essential than ever. Monitoring requires tangible results for the costly financial investments in data source application development. Many database advancement initiatives cannot generate the results they promise. Choosing the ideal modern technology and approach for every level in an organization is important to making the most of return on investment. This implies selecting the very best overall return, which doesn't indicate selecting the least costly preliminary option. This is often one of the most important choice a primary details policeman (CIO) or primary innovation officer (CTO) makes.

Taking Care Of Human Resources.

Taking care of individuals to personalize innovation is challenging. The more complex the modern technology or application, the less people are qualified to manage it, and also the a lot more expensive they are to hire. Turn over is constantly a problem, and having the right standards is critical to efficiently supporting legacy applications. Training and also keeping up with technology are additionally challenging.

Rapid Release.

Producing database applications swiftly is necessary, not only for reducing prices, but for responding to interior or client demands. The capacity to create applications promptly supplies a significant competitive advantage.

The IT supervisor is responsible for supplying options and also making tradeoffs to support business needs of the company. By using different modern technologies, you can supply business choice manufacturers options, such as a 60 percent remedy in three months, a 90 percent option in twelve months, or a 99 percent service in twenty-four months. (Instead of months, maybe bucks.) In some cases, time to market is most essential, other times it might be price, and also other times functions or security are most important. Demands transform quickly and are unforeseeable. We stay in a "adequate" rather than a best globe, so recognizing the best ways to provide "sufficient" options promptly provides you and also your company a competitive edge.

Flexibility as well as Maintainability.
Despite the most effective system layout, by the time numerous month growth initiatives are finished, requires adjustment. Variations adhere to variations, as well as a system that's created to be adaptable and able to fit modification could imply the distinction in between success as well as failing for the individuals' professions.


Systems ought to be developed to manage the expected information and also more. But many systems are never finished, are disposed of soon, or change a lot with time that the first evaluations are wrong. Scalability is very important, however commonly lesser than a fast option. If the application effectively supports development, scalability can be added later when it's economically justified.

Leave a Reply

Your email address will not be published. Required fields are marked *